Additionally, Burchell's Zebra has wide black stripes with thinner shadow stripes of brown or gray. The stripes progressively fade right into a lighter shade of gray down their body, and their legs have fewer stripes. This sample confuses predators and deters biting insects.

Squealing is frequently created when in discomfort, but can be read in helpful interactions. Zebras also communicate with Visible shows, and the pliability of their lips will allow them to generate complicated facial expressions. Visible displays also encompass head, ear, and tail postures. A zebra could sign an intention to kick by dropping back its ears and whipping its tail. Flattened ears, bared enamel as well as a waving head might be applied as threatening gestures by stallions.[28]

Plains and mountain zebra foals are cared for mostly by their moms. However, if pack-hunting hyenas and pet dogs threaten them, the entire dazzle tries to protect them by forming a protecting front While using the foals in the center, with the stallion speeding at something that comes way too close.

In harem-Keeping species, Grownup ladies mate only with their harem stallion, even though male Grévy's zebras build territories which catch the attention of ladies plus the species is promiscuous. Zebras talk to different vocalisations, entire body postures and facial expressions. Social grooming strengthens social bonds in plains and mountain zebras.
